    Corticosteroid-binding globulin (CBG), also known as Serpin A6 or Transcortin, is the primary transport protein for glucocorticoids and progestins in the blood across nearly all vertebrate species. It plays a critical role in regulating the bioavailability and distribution of these steroid hormones. The full-length protein is secreted into the extracellular space, where it functions in systemic hormone transport.
